JOB SUMMARY:
Do you have your HR qualification with three years plus experience managing the human resource service, recruitment, employee relations, payroll & benefits administration and assisting with compliance, learning and development.
 
Our client, an NGO based in Observatory in Cape Town requires your caring and attentive attitude to be accountable for the operational day-to-day running of HR administration tasks promoting an inclusive, collaborative, and high-performance culture.

JOB DESCRIPTION:

REQUIREMENTS

  • Matric, Degree/ 3-year diploma qualification in Human Resources or related area
  • 3 years plus work experience in a generalist Human Resources role
  • Experience working in a non-profit organisation and basic knowledge of Immigration regulations advantageous
  • Strong understanding and knowledge - LRA, BCEA, EE, SDA, OHS and POPI, and their application thereof
  • Solid recruitment and selection experience within an equal opportunities’ framework
  • Self-motivated with high energy levels & ability to deal with confidential and information
  • Experience maintaining an HR Management Information System & basic knowledge of Employee Assistance Programmes
  • Strong interpersonal relationship and communication skills and ability to take initiative
  • Prioritise, committed, motivated and able to achieve tasks in required time frame
  • Comfortable with diversity, dedication to social justice and promoting health and social change
  • Operate in an environment of cultural diversity, build and sustain a culture that enables critical reflection, transparency, dignity, mutual recognition and support


DUTIES

  • HR Strategies and Administration, contribute to the implementation of annual HR workplans
  • Actively participate in the diversity, equity & inclusion activities
  • Manage payroll processing staff benefits, addition of new hires, terminations
  • Participate in on boarding and exit interviews processes
  • Manage staff exit processes, compile confidential report and share with the Senior HR
  • Recruitment and Selection, coordinate and manage all aspects of the recruitment
  • Participate in interviews as required
  • Performance management, provide advice and support on performance related issues
  • Contribute to a team culture that values collaboration internally, cross functionally and in partnership with other functions
  • Administer rewards programmes
  • Arrange staff wellness days/ participate in staff engagement initiatives
  • Participate in internal disciplinary processes and procedures including CCMA preparations
  • Arrange disciplinary processes, capture all disciplinary records on Payspace
  • Source training service providers as per the needs of the organisation
  • Prepare and submit information to SETA as necessary
  • Optimise relevant HR processes and systems (Payspace)
  • Manage any other allocated by the Senior HR Manager
  • Value Practice, commitment to develop, promote and practice companies’ vision, mission, values and strategy

Salary: R negotiable, dependent on experience
